Software Engineer Interview Guide – Mastering Data Structures & Algorithms

 thumbnail

Software Engineer Interview Guide – Mastering Data Structures & Algorithms

Published Mar 09, 25
7 min read
[=headercontent]How To Talk About Your Projects In A Software Engineer Interview [/headercontent] [=image]
Senior Software Engineer Interview Study Plan – A Complete Guide

How To Use Openai & Chatgpt To Practice Coding Interviews




[/video]

the listing goes on. The end goal is to have one generic copy of your resume all set which has actually been prepared such that it demonstrates every one of your skills, and various other individuals can see that. You can currently tweak this according to the business you are putting on and the certifications that they are looking for.

Software Engineering Interview Tips From Hiring Managers

The 3-month Coding Interview Preparation Bootcamp – Is It Worth It?


I like it myself - I just do not think it is a reliable source for the very first stages of your preparation. The benefit of utilizing LeetCode, whether you like it or hate it, is that it has layouts of inquiries frequently made use of by tech firms in coding rounds. So obtaining practice will only help you! The method is to build a skill that can help you decode - provided this issue, what are the formulas in my "toolbox" that I can utilize to solve this problem.

If I had to offer you my very own example, I have not also touched 200 questions on LeetCode myself and I assume I did quite well in my meetings. The various other source that people like to use is Breaking the Coding Interview. I have that book, I think it is terrific, I just have actually never been able to use it myself.

If you are someone who is much more effective alone, after that sure. Research for them alone. Real meetings will have at least one more individual, if not even more and it is crucial that you have actually practiced giving the interview to one other person (and not just your screen). Technical Meetings are not just regarding composing the excellent code and making certain it puts together, you will likewise have to describe your mind and why you are doing what you are doing.

Occasionally if you are running out of time and can not complete the code, but can describe what your purposes are, you might still escape and clear that round. I will return to the same point that I said is very important for your resume: responses. We are all scared of failing and allowing another person understand what our problems are, yet much better a friend/peer than than the job interviewer.

Top Coding Interview Mistakes & How To Avoid Them

It will certainly help me make material better matched to the requirements of the people seeing. If you have certain questions concerning any type of component of the process, drop them below!.

But this is still meant to be a functional, not academic, discussion. Attract from your previous experience and usage accurate examples to describe what you would certainly do and why. And like all of our meeting inquiries, it will be made to "ladder," meaning your interviewer's follow-ups can get moreor lesschallenging as you advance.

This is part of how we evaluate discovering dexterity; we wish to know how well you think on your feet. In the manager interview, we'll discuss who you are todayand that you want to be at Atlassian. Naturally, throughout the interview process, we intend to make sure we learn more about candidates as humansand we want them to get to know us.

In this sessionusually individually with either the hiring manager or a more elderly manager on the teamwe'll ask inquiries designed to comprehend not simply who you are, but additionally what you're interested in and excited about. We'll speak about just how you can include value not only in the function and group you're looking for, yet in your long-lasting career at Atlassian.

We'll likewise use this session to learn as long as we can about just how you function, particularly your partnership and communication designs. See to it you're prepared to chat concerning a previous task or more, from that you worked with to the technical difficulties you had to overcome. You can likewise talk to business justification for the projectthe factor you were dealing with it in the initial area.

The Top 10 Websites To Practice Software Engineer Interview Questions

Communication and partnership are vital skills on our group, so simply think of it as one more chance to show your things. The worths meeting is developed to assess your alignment withand address your inquiries aboutAtlassian's 5 worths.

They're the backbone on which a sustainable business is developed. And because our worths are woven right into our practices, processes, and the method we run our teams, your values recruiter most likely won't be a participant of the team you're using to join; it might be someone from Sales, HUMAN RESOURCES, or Customer Support.

The Best Free Coursera Courses For Technical Interview Preparation

How To Prepare For A Front-end Engineer Interview In 2025


Our objective is to comprehend your way of thinking, and the way it guides your activities. After successfully completing the meeting procedure, your recruiters will certainly consolidate responses and debrief. If there's an excellent fit in between your skills and experience, you will proceed to the last stage at the same time - being assessed by a Hiring Board.

29 Common Software Engineer Interview Questions (With Expert Answers)

Atlassian working with board members are different from the job interviewers you will certainly satisfy and just have accessibility to details details connecting to the meeting process (this includes interview responses and curriculum vitae details). The working with board will look holistically at abilities, toughness and behaviors, guaranteeing an objective working with decision. As you undergo this procedure, we desire you to have a fantastic experience - and we desire to do whatever we can to draw out the most effective in you, due to the fact that it's your finest that will certainly identify how you can add to our group.

How To Ace Faang Behavioral Interviews – A Complete Guide

What Are The Most Common Faang Coding Interview Questions?


Interaction and cooperation are essential skills on our team, so just believe of it as an additional possibility to show your things. Instead, we're bringing in people with a vast range of abilities, histories, and viewpoints, and giving them every feasible possibility to put their best foot forward.

9 Software Engineer Interview Questions You Should Be Ready For

Sufficient prep work not only increases your confidence yet likewise aids you display your knowledge and stand apart from the competitors. This is where ChatGPT action in. Developed by OpenAI, ChatGPT is a remarkable tool that can transform your interview preparation experience. With its comprehensive expertise and conversational capacities, ChatGPT becomes your trusted companion, giving important support, understandings, and support throughout your journey.

This blog intends to lead software program engineers on exactly how to utilize ChatGPT successfully for meeting prep work. From gathering meeting info to practicing technical questions and enhancing soft abilities, this blog will certainly aid you take advantage of ChatGPT as an important source. By the end of this blog, you will certainly have a clear understanding of just how to effectively utilize ChatGPT to enhance your chances of success in software program engineer meetings.

How To Prepare For A Software Or Technical Interview – A Step-by-step Guide

These interviews assess your ability to develop scalable and reliable software systems. You may be asked to detail the architecture, parts, and scalability factors to consider for a provided situation.

It has the possible to be a useful source for software application programmers that are getting ready for meetings. ChatGPT can assist in preparing interview questions, exercising technical troubles, and enhancing soft abilities to its massive data base and capacity to generate pertinent and insightful solutions. ChatGPT can be a wonderful resource for meeting prep work, giving various possibilities to boost your preparedness.

ChatGPT acts as your online job interviewer, providing you an immersive prep work experience with its interactive and dynamic conversational capacities. "I'm presently getting ready for a work meeting in (Work Title). Could you please play the duty of interviewer and ask me some concerns? Please ask me (Number of Concerns) questions, one by one:"Use ChatGPT to Practice Mock Meeting "As a (Your Function) candidate, I am presently planning for this setting.

Could you please create meeting inquiries connected to these ideas to assist me exercise?" Check out this real-time ChatGPT conversation: If you prepare for interview concerns but lack the responses, ChatGPT can be a helpful resource. It can produce responses to assist you understand and plan for those concerns, supplying crucial understandings to help you improve your knowledge and preparedness.